分析了印制电路板(printed circuit board,PCB)平面型空心线圈的结构与原理,对PCB电子式电流互感器的频率特性、稳态特性及暂态特性进行了仿真分析与试验研究,提出了数字式电流互感器的结构。结果表明:PCB电子式电流互感器测量范围大、工作频带宽、暂态响应快、稳态性能好且具有良好的线性度,适合小电流(100A以下)测量。
The structure and principle of printed circuit board (PCB) planar-type of air core coil are analyzed; simulation analysis and experimental investigation of frequency characteristic, steady-state characteristic and transient characteristic of PCB electronic current transformer are carried out; then the structure of digital current transformer is given. Simulation and experimental results show that PCB electronic current transformer possesses such features as wide measuring range, wide working frequency band, fast transient response, good steady-state performance and good linearity, so it is suitable for the measurement of small current lower than 100A.
